巧妙安裝MySQL數據庫在Ubuntu操作系統中
MySQL是一個流行的開源關聯數據庫管理系統,廣泛應用於各種應用程序中。本文將介紹如何在Ubuntu操作系統中巧妙地安裝MySQL數據庫,並提供一些最佳實踐和技巧,以確保安裝過程順利進行。
前期準備
在開始安裝MySQL之前,首先需要確保您的Ubuntu系統是最新的。可以通過以下命令更新系統:
sudo apt update
sudo apt upgrade更新完成後,您可以開始安裝MySQL。
安裝MySQL
在Ubuntu中安裝MySQL非常簡單。您只需執行以下命令:
sudo apt install mysql-server這將安裝MySQL服務器及其相關的依賴項。在安裝過程中,系統可能會提示您設置MySQL的root用戶密碼。請務必記住這個密碼,因為您將需要它來訪問數據庫。
配置MySQL
安裝完成後,您可以使用以下命令啟動MySQL服務:
sudo systemctl start mysql為了確保MySQL在系統啟動時自動啟動,您可以執行以下命令:
sudo systemctl enable mysql接下來,建議您運行MySQL的安全性腳本,以提高數據庫的安全性。執行以下命令:
sudo mysql_secure_installation這個腳本將引導您完成一些安全設置,包括移除匿名用戶、禁止root遠程登錄以及刪除測試數據庫等。根據提示進行操作即可。
訪問MySQL
完成配置後,您可以使用以下命令登錄到MySQL:
sudo mysql -u root -p系統會提示您輸入之前設置的root用戶密碼。成功登錄後,您將看到MySQL的命令提示符,這意味著您已經成功安裝並配置了MySQL數據庫。
創建數據庫和用戶
在MySQL中,您可以創建數據庫和用戶以便於管理。以下是創建數據庫和用戶的基本命令:
CREATE DATABASE my_database;
CREATE USER 'my_user'@'localhost' IDENTIFIED BY 'my_password';
GRANT ALL PRIVILEGES ON my_database.* TO 'my_user'@'localhost';
FLUSH PRIVILEGES;這些命令將創建一個名為“my_database”的數據庫,並創建一個名為“my_user”的用戶,該用戶擁有對該數據庫的所有權限。
最佳實踐
- 定期備份數據庫,以防止數據丟失。
- 使用強密碼來保護數據庫用戶。
- 定期更新MySQL以獲取最新的安全補丁。
- 監控數據庫性能,及時調整配置以優化性能。
總結
在Ubuntu操作系統中安裝MySQL數據庫是一個相對簡單的過程,只需幾個步驟即可完成。通過遵循上述步驟,您可以確保您的MySQL數據庫安全且高效運行。如果您需要更高效的數據庫解決方案,考慮使用香港VPS來托管您的MySQL數據庫,這樣可以獲得更好的性能和穩定性。